TenneT is a leading European grid operator committed to a secure and reliable electricity supply – 24 hours a day, 365 days a year. We are shaping the energy transition for a sustainable energy future. As the first cross-border transmission system operator, we plan, build and operate an almost 25,000 kilometres long high and extra-high voltage grid in the Netherlands and Germany and are one of the largest investors in national and international electricity grids, on land and at sea. Every day, our 7,400 employees give their best and ensure with responsibility, courage and networking that more than 43 million end consumers can rely on a stable electricity supply.
